Get started7 Cricketers Close is a one-bedroom semi-detached house in Erith (DA8 1TU). It has a recorded floor area of 36 m² (around 388 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(July 2021)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(September 2009);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and main heating d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 73). Main heating runs on electricity. At 36 m² this is the 6th smallest of 44 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 33–61 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to B across 44 units on file.
Untraded for 25 years, with the last transfer in September 2001. Today's modelled estimate of £178,000 sits 203% above the 2001 sale of £58,750.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£152/sq ft) was about 25.4% below the postcode norm. At 36 m² it sits well below the postcode median (52 m² across 43 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ally.
